Hey everyone, I have this problem with the use of "unless." The most common use of unless means "except if." For example: I will come unless it rains. But there were few instances where unless only means "if." For example: You can write about it unless it makes sense. So how do I know in which context is unless being used? Especially if it is just a single sentence. Thanks in advance.

Your second example is wrong (and non-native). If we fix it, you'll understand: "you cannot write about it unless (= except if) it makes sense".
